Nicole Young, the estranged wife of producer Dr. Dre, came under fire last week after it was revealed that she had requested almost $2 million a month in temporary spousal support.
She has revealed why she needs so much money. According to Young, she needs:
$135,000 a month for clothes
$20,000 a month for phone and email
$10,000 a month for laundry
$900,000 a month for entertainment
$60,000 on education
$125,000 on charitable contributions
$100,000 on a mortgage
Young is claiming that her prenup with the star is no longer valid, as he tore it up years ago.
“Andre, at the time, was a well-known producer and rapper in the music industry, but he had not reached anywhere near the pinnacle of his music, entertainment and business career that he achieved during our marriage,” she said. “He told me that I must sign a premarital agreement or he would not marry me.
“I was extremely reluctant, resistant and afraid to sign the agreement and felt backed into a corner,” Young described, adding that Dre “acknowledged to me that he felt ashamed he had pressured me into signing a premarital agreement and he tore up multiple copies of the agreement in front of me” about two to three after they tied the knot.
